Transaction 8fc4ae206653613456efd5be3b31cd3aa705f8aedfcc730455f2bc178fa85a92
1 Input
1 Output
-
8fc4ae206653613456efd5be3b31cd3aa705f8aedfcc730455f2bc178fa85a92:0
- value
- 1040827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08361e0854b53780c5f30bac870825393df4aadd OP_EQUAL
- address
- 32SSADSeQEHXrSMMLXKpeTXDF9gpkdVSSQ